The answer is: a. 40

Why?

We are working with composite functions, so, to find the correct option, first we need to follow the composite function process:


(h\circ g)=h(g(x))

So,

We are given the functions:


g(x)=2x\\\\h(x)=x^(2)+4

So,


(h\circ g)(x)=(2x)^(2)+4

Then, evaluating with "x" equal to -3, we have:


(h\circ g)(-3)=(2*-3)^(2)+4=(-6)^(2)+4=36+4=40

So, the correct option is a. 40

Answer:

a. 40

Explanation:

Given


g(x)=2x and
h(x)=x^2+4


(h\circ g)(x)=h(g(x))


(h\circ g)(x)=h(2x)

We plug in 2x into
h(x)=x^2+4.


(h\circ g)(x)=(2x)^2+4


(h\circ g)(x)=4x^2+4

We now substitute x=-3.


(h\circ g)(-3)=4(-3)^2+4


(h\circ g)(-3)=36+4=40

The correct choice is A.
